The Israel Innovation Authority plans to invest NIS 100 million ($33 million) to establish national infrastructure for research and development that will help local companies and universities test, evaluate, and adopt advanced quantum computing technologies.
To that end, the authority on Monday announced a request for proposals to launch and operate a national quantum computing R&D infrastructure center. The call for proposals is intended for industrial corporations that will establish and provide R&D services to Israeli companies and research institutions active in quantum computing.
The center will allow local companies and researchers to experiment, compare platforms, assess performance, and develop new applications across a range of quantum computing architectures. The infrastructure will integrate at least three different quantum processing technologies.
“Quantum computing is expected to fundamentally transform the way industries address highly complex computational challenges,” said Israel Innovation Authority CEO Dror Bin.
“We aim to provide Israeli industry and academia with a state-of-the-art R&D infrastructure that will enable them to evaluate, integrate, and adopt quantum computing technologies, transforming scientific and technological knowledge into a competitive advantage for Israeli high-tech while strengthening Israel’s position as a global leader in this field,” he said.

Quantum processors promise computational horsepower to solve the most complex problems where regular computers fail. The tech could lead to breakthroughs in the areas of economics, technology, security, engineering, and science, in fields such as drug discovery, cryptography, financial modeling, and in streamlining supply-chain logistics.
Israel’s program comes as the global race to develop practical and useful software to make quantum computing more workable and accessible heats up. Major global economies have launched national quantum initiatives, led by China and the US, with multi-billion-dollar investments in research, infrastructure, and talent development.

Israel lacks both the strategy and the massive investments that allow countries like the US, the UAE and Saudi Arabia to make huge leaps forward in the realm of quantum computing.
Israel has the talent and a track record of innovation, but is falling short of the much-needed investment in infrastructure, including computing power and chips. That could put the country at a disadvantage as other countries, including its neighbors, are pushing ahead in the global technological arms race.
“Establishing a national R&D infrastructure is expected to enable Israeli companies to evaluate different technologies, shorten development cycles, build practical expertise, and develop the capabilities needed to compete in the rapidly evolving global quantum ecosystem,” the Israel Innovation Authority said in a statement.
Following the deadline for proposals on October 8, and the completion of the selection process, the Israel Innovation Authority expects a national quantum computing R&D infrastructure to be established within a year. R&D services include access to hardware testing, cloud-based software development, and algorithm evaluation across multiple quantum technologies.
The infrastructure is part of the Israel National Quantum Initiative, launched in 2018 to facilitate relevant quantum research, develop human capital in the field, encourage industrial projects, and invite international cooperation on R&D.
In June 2024, Israel opened the Israeli Quantum Computing Center (IQCC), which provides access to advanced research facilities for local startups and academia.
“It was launched at a time when Israeli quantum processors were not yet available and therefore relied on foreign processors,” the Israel Innovation Authority said. “The current call for proposals is intended to establish an Israeli quantum computing technology and, on that basis, provide R&D services to Israeli academia and industry.”
Israel is home to about 20 quantum computing startups, developing everything from software systems to full quantum processors and accounts for 9 percent of global private investment in the field, according to the Israel Innovation Authority. Among the startups are Classiq and Quantum Machines.
